    • This. As for your options - I suggest remote mounting the Nissan sensor further away on a length of steel tube. That tube to have a loop in it to handle vibration, etc etc. You will need to either put a tee and a bleed fitting near the sensor, or crack the fitting at the sensor to bleed it full of oil when you first set it up, otherwise you won't get the line filled. But this is a small problem. Just needs enough access to get it done.

It became immediately apparent as soon as I looked around more closely. 795d266d-a034-4b8c-89c9-d83860f5d00a.mp4       This is the R34 GTT oil sender connected via an adapter to an oil cooler block I have installed which runs AN lines to my cooler (and back). There's also an oil temp sensor on top.  Just after that video, I attempted to unthread the sensor to see if it's loose/worn and it disintegrated in my hand. So yes. I am glad I noticed that oil because it would appear that complete and utter catastrophic engine failure was about 1 second of engine runtime away. I did try to drill the fitting out, and only succeeded in drilling the middle hole much larger and now there's a... smooth hole in there with what looks like a damn sleeve still incredibly tight in there. Not really sure how to proceed from here. My options: 1) Find someone who can remove the stuck fitting, and use a steel adapter so it won't fatigue? (Female BSPT for the R34 sender to 1/8NPT male - HARD to find). IF it isn't possible to remove - Buy a new block ($320) and have someone tap a new 1/8NPT in the top of it ($????) and hope the steel adapter works better. 2) Buy a new block and give up on the OEM pressure sender for the dash entirely, and use the supplied 1/8 NPT for the oil temp sender. Having the oil pressure read 0 in the dash with the warning lamp will give me a lot of anxiety driving around. I do have the actual GM sensor/sender working, but it needs OBD2 as a gauge. If I'm datalogging I don't actually have a readout of what the gauge is currently displaying. 3) Other? Find a new location for the OEM sender? Though I don't know of anywhere that will work. I also don't know if a steel adapter is actually functionally smart here. It's clearly leveraged itself through vibration of the motor and snapped in half. This doesn't seem like a setup a smart person would replicate given the weight of the OEM sender.
